Understanding CFM: What Does It Mean?

CFM stands for Cubic Feet per Minute, a measurement of airflow rate used in ventilation systems, including over-the-range microwaves. Essentially, it quantifies the amount of air that can be moved or circulated within a specified time frame.

Strong ventilation is crucial in kitchens to eliminate smoke, steam, and odors generated during cooking. The CFM rating is a key indicator of a microwave’s ability to effectively ventilate your kitchen. Therefore, it’s essential to understand this measurement when shopping for an over-the-range microwave.

Finding the Right CFM for Your Kitchen

The ideal CFM rating for an over-the-range microwave can depend on several factors, including the size of your kitchen, the types of meals you typically prepare, and your overall cooking habits. Below are some key considerations to help you determine the best CFM for your situation.

Kitchen Size and Layout

The size of your kitchen plays a significant role in determining the necessary CFM rating. Generally, you’ll want a higher CFM for larger kitchens to ensure adequate air circulation.

  • Small Kitchens: If your kitchen is compact, a microwave with a CFM rating of 300-400 CFM is often sufficient. This range can typically handle the smoke and odors produced in smaller spaces without being too overpowering.
  • Medium to Large Kitchens: For larger kitchens, especially those used for serious cooking with lots of frying, grilling, or roasting, you may want a microwave with a CFM rating of 400-600 CFM. This ensures effective ventilation over a larger area.

Cooking Habits

Your cooking habits greatly influence the CFM you’ll need.

  • Casual Cooks: If you mostly use your microwave for reheating or simple meal prep, a CFM rating around 300-400 CFM should suffice.
  • Frequent Cooks: However, if you regularly prepare complex meals requiring frying or grilling, look for models with 500-600 CFM or higher to ensure adequate air removal.

Type of Ventilation System

Over-the-range microwaves typically offer two types of ventilation systems: ducted and non-ducted.

  • Ducted Ventilation: This system expels air outside your home and is usually more effective, making higher CFM ratings more necessary.
  • Non-Ducted Ventilation: This uses filters to recirculate air back into the kitchen. While these models may have lower CFM ratings, the effectiveness of the filter system can still play an essential role in air quality.

CFM Guidelines Based on Cooking Style

Cooking Style Recommended CFM
Light Cooking (Reheating, Steaming) 300-400 CFM
Moderate Cooking (Baking, Boiling) 400-500 CFM
Heavy Cooking (Frying, Grilling) 500-600 CFM+

Is higher CFM always better for over-the-range microwaves?

Higher CFM values are generally associated with greater ventilation capacity, which can be advantageous in dealing with strong cooking odors and smoke. However, higher CFM microwaves can also create more noise, which might be a consideration for some users. It’s essential to weigh the benefits of effective ventilation against the potential for increased noise levels.

Moreover, the effectiveness of ventilation is not solely dependent on CFM. Duct size, the type of installation, and the position of the microwave can also affect performance. Therefore, it’s crucial to consider a combination of factors rather than relying solely on the CFM rating when making your choice.

What is the typical range of CFM for over-the-range microwaves?

The CFM for over-the-range microwaves typically ranges from about 200 to 600 CFM, catering to various cooking styles and kitchen environments. Lower-end models, ideal for light cooking and reheating, usually start around the 200 to 300 CFM mark. This level is usually sufficient for simple meal prep.

On the other hand, higher-end models designed for more serious cooking endeavors can reach 400 to 600 CFM or even higher. These units are especially beneficial for households that frequently engage in high-heat cooking methods, such as frying or grilling, where efficient ventilation is crucial for maintaining air quality.
